Subject: Monthly partitioning rollout — eventlog tables

On-call folks: tonight's migration splits the Quarrystone eventlog into monthly partitions. Writes route automatically; old queries keep working via the parent table. Expect elevated lock wait for roughly ten minutes at 02:00. Rollback script is staged and tested. If paging fires, check partition creation first. The deployed build is identified below.

build token for fahap-yagag: htk3_d09

Handover: Timezone handling in report exports (Quillbarrow Analytics)

For the security review: all exports now normalize to UTC at ingest, with the display offset applied only in the renderer. Marla's patch removed the legacy local-time branch, so audit logs are consistent. The export signing vault was re-keyed during this change; the new recovery passphrase is below.

vault phrase of bagaf-kajeg = jorath-feniel-briir-siliel-ralix

Hey Marit, handing over the Tollgrave library catalogue import before I log off. The overnight batch from Fenwick Archives stalled around record 48k — looks like malformed subject headings, not our parser. I've got a retry patch up for review with better skip logic and a dead-letter queue. Please eyeball the dedupe change especially; it's a bit hairy. Nothing's on fire, the catalogue is just a day stale. Questions on the patch go here.

alerts address for fafop-tajog: keleth.joreth.fravan@qorvelhq.corp

Onboarding — Schema Registry (Eventspool). Every event published through Eventspool must validate against a schema registered in the Corvane registry. On-call engineers should verify the consumer's env file points at the correct registry cluster via REGISTRY_URL before restarting a lagging consumer. Immediately after that line, the file sets the registry access secret.

env line for fafof-fahag: LEDGER_TOKEN5=f8790

Ticket: Staging env misconfigured for Siftgate bloom filter

The bloom layer in front of the Pellet KV store is rejecting all lookups in staging because the env file was copied from the dev template without credentials. False-positive tuning values are fine; only the auth line is missing. To unblock the weekly demo, the Pellet admission secret must be set on the following line.

env line for yaguf-fajop: LEDGER_TOKEN13=fb08984397349